INTRODUCTION
The Purchasing and Supply Chain Management Training Program will introduce you to the fundamental aspects of the supply chain environment, including enterprise resource planning systems and requirement systems. The interrelationships between purchasing, vendor selection, sources of supply, and technology will also be explored in this program. The focus is on management and the skills and resources that a successful manager needs.

COURSE OBJECTIVES
Upon completion of this training course, participants will be able to:
- Be familiar with the basics of purchasing and the purchasing environment.
- Have an understanding of the various approaches, tools, and strategies used in negotiations.
- Learn the basics of entrepreneurship.
- Understand the marketing management and the strategies involved in developing a marketing plan.
- Become aware of the subjects in the field of price and cost analysis from a purchasing and production perspective.
- Be able to promote recognition and acceptance of professional status for certified people involved in purchasing and supply chain operations among other areas of business management.
- Be able to develop performance standards and operational guidelines; which can improve the efficiency and effectiveness of purchasing and supply chain.
- Be able to develop and live by a code of ethical standards for purchasing and supply chain operations under which modern business practices might be more clearly understood and favorably accepted by the public in general.
- Increase in personal confidence, satisfaction, and pride from direct involvement in purchasing and supply chain operations.
